The Restaurant Cook role at Neiman Marcus is an integral part of the company’s hospitality and food services team. This position operates onsite at their San Francisco, California location, playing a vital role in maintaining the quality and presentation of food items served in the retail restaurant environment. The Restaurant Cook supports the main restaurant associates by preparing food with a keen eye towards cost control and inventory profitability. This includes managing daily and weekly food inventories effectively and coordinating production according to daily menus and special event requirements. The cook is responsible for ensuring that guests receive high-quality food and beverage service in alignment with Neiman Marcus’s dedication to excellence.

This job demands a proactive approach to kitchen operations, including communication with supervisors for special preparations, maintaining sanitary and health standards, and keeping all workstations clean and organized. The role also involves equipment maintenance and timely reporting of malfunctions to ensure seamless kitchen functionality. Moreover, the cook helps control waste by careful production planning using menu counts and build-to sheets. Attention to detail is vital, especially regarding special orders and keeping up with supply demands throughout the day while minimizing waste.

The position requires physical activity such as standing for extended periods, bending, climbing stairs, and lifting up to 35 pounds. Availability during evenings, weekends, and holidays is mandatory, reflecting the dynamic nature of the retail and food service industry. Job Duties

  • Maintain an active role in the smoothness and efficiency of retail restaurant operations by producing and coordinating the production of food items needed for daily menus and special events
  • Control daily and weekly inventories
  • Maintain team awareness of inventory cost and profitability through proper use of production, build-to, and order sheets
  • Check in with supervisor for any special preparation needed before starting normal kitchen tasks
  • Coordinate production of daily menu items using menu count and production (or build-to sheets) to help control waste
  • Check inventory of all menus
  • Communicate supply needs for production with head cook
  • Maintain a clean and organized work area keeping in mind all health and sanitation standards to assure integrity of food products
  • Maintain equipment daily and report any malfunctions to designated Associate
  • Maintain flow of food orders by communicating with Associates promptly
  • Verify all special orders with designated Associate
  • Maintain production of menu items throughout the day, keeping up with supply demands and making serious efforts to avoid wasted items
  • Close and sanitize work area promptly according to health codes and gather items required for next day's production
  • Communicate any supplies that need to be ordered to supervisor
  • Check in with a supervisor before leaving
  • Uphold all Health and Sanitation standards as directed by Neiman Marcus, local Health Department, and 3rd party Sanitation auditors
